The Core Elements of a Powerful Brand Identity
A strong brand identity is built on several interconnected elements that, when combined effectively, create a cohesive and memorable impression.
- Logo as the face of the company: We’ve touched on this, but it bears repeating. Your logo is often the very first visual interaction a potential customer has with your brand. It’s the visual shorthand for everything you represent, and it needs to be memorable, personable, and welcoming.
- Color palette and typography setting the emotional tone: Colors aren’t just pretty; they evoke powerful emotions and associations. A carefully chosen color palette can communicate trust, excitement, sophistication, or warmth. Similarly, typography (the fonts you use) carries its own “spirit,” shaping how your message is perceived. The right combination can instantly convey your brand’s personality before a single word is read.
- Messaging and brand voice giving it a personality: What you say and how you say it are just as critical as how you look. Your brand messaging includes your taglines, unique selling points, mission, and vision statements. Your brand voice defines the tone and style of all your communication, ensuring it’s consistent whether you’re writing a social media post or an important business proposal.
- Visuals and imagery creating a consistent aesthetic: Beyond the logo, this includes the style of photography, illustrations, icons, and even video you use. A consistent visual aesthetic helps reinforce your brand, making it instantly recognizable across all platforms. Questions to Ask a Potential brand identity design agency
When you’re interviewing agencies, ask insightful questions that get to the heart of their process and philosophy:
- What is your process for understanding our business and goals? This question reveals how deeply they’ll engage with your unique situation. Look for answers that detail research, findy sessions, and a commitment to understanding your culture and aspirations.
- How do you measure the success of a new brand identity? A good agency will talk about more than just aesthetics. They should discuss metrics like brand recognition, customer engagement, market positioning, and ultimately, how their work helps strengthen your business and achieve your objectives.
- Can you show us examples of brand guidelines you’ve created? This helps you understand the thoroughness of their documentation. You want to see a comprehensive digital brand guide that acts as a clear resource for how to use your brand assets.
- How will you ensure our new identity works across all our marketing channels? Given today’s multi-platform world, consistency is key. Their answer should demonstrate an understanding of how your brand will translate across digital, print, social media, and beyond, especially for local businesses in areas like Newtown or Philadelphia, where diverse touchpoints are common.

How long does the branding process usually take?
Just like cost, there’s no single answer to how long the branding process takes, but we can give you a general idea. A typical, comprehensive brand identity project can take anywhere from 4 to 12 weeks, and sometimes even longer for very complex situations. It truly depends on several factors:
- Complexity of the project: Are you starting from scratch, or is it a refresh? How many touchpoints will the brand need to cover?
- Number of deliverables: A project that includes a logo, color palette, typography, and basic guidelines will be quicker than one that also requires packaging design, website mockups, and extensive messaging frameworks.
- Client feedback and collaboration: The quicker and clearer the feedback, the smoother the process tends to be. A good agency will set clear timelines and milestones from the start, keeping you informed every step of the way.

What’s the difference between brand identity and brand image?
This is a fantastic question that often confuses people! Let’s clear it up.
- Brand Identity: This is what you strategically create and control. It’s the sum of all the tangible elements you design and implement to represent your business. Think of your logo, color palette, typography, brand voice, messaging, visual style, and brand guidelines. This is your intentional effort to communicate who you are.
- Brand Image: This is the result, the perception that lives in the minds of your audience. It’s how customers, potential customers, and the general public actually perceive your brand in the real world. This perception is influenced not only by your brand identity but also by customer experiences, word-of-mouth, marketing campaigns, and even current events.
The ultimate goal of a great brand identity design agency is to make sure your carefully crafted brand identity perfectly aligns with your brand image. We want what you put out there to be exactly how people see and feel about your business, creating a strong and authentic connection between your brand and your audience.
